We now come to the comparative utility of the two machines. It is admitted that the plaintiff’s is of so much greater practical usefulness that it has superseded Howe’s, and driven it out of use. As we have before stated, greater utility implies a difference in the machines. But it is insisted that in the present case that rule does not apply, because it is said that this greater utility arises from two causes: first, that the back and front not being fastened together in the plaintiff’s machine, the backs may be changed with greater facility than in Howe’s, and second, that the plaintiff’s may.be made of wood, whereas, Howe’s require metal. But this explanation shows that the plaintiff’s machine has capabilities important to its practical use, which Howe’s has not, and these new capabilities are at least some evidence that the means, the machine, are different.
We have thus far not inquired into the ultimate effect of the one tree or the other; nor whether the plaintiff’s machine will accomplish the work of treeing a boot any better than Howe’s. It is insisted by the defendant that the plaintiff’s has no such quality as he claims for it, of filling-the foot first, and the leg afterward, any more than Howe’s; and that in both, the foot and the leg are practically filled successively in the same manner and with equal facility and utility, at least when applied to the common run and various classes of boots, although it is admitted that as to a single class of boots the plaintiff’s may have some advantage over Howe’s in dispensing with the strap at the top. If this were so it would by no means follow that the two machines are the same. There are many instances of distinct patentable inventions producing the same result, that is, accomplishing the same work. For example, the Woodworth and Norcross planing machines not only plane a board equally well, but both do it by means of a rotary cutter applied to the surface. Yet the mechanism being different both properly received patents. A new machine which accomplishes the same end as a former, but by substantially different means, is patentable.
If, therefore, the mechanism used by Fames is materially different from that used by Howe, and especially if it be of such increased utility as to have wholly superseded Howe’s, it is no answer to his claim for a patent to say, that after all the boot was as well treed by Howe’s as it is by the plaintiff’s. And it is unnecessary to eiffer into the question whether it was so or not. But it is insisted that the plaintiff’s machine will not accomplish what he asserts it will. Now, if an invention be both new and useful, it can not be impeached because it does not accomplish all that a sanguine inventor has claimed for it. The defendant insists that in the ordinary use of the plaintiff’s machine for various classes and sizes of boots, it is necessary to use a strap at the top to limit the operation ■of the stretching force and prevent the leg from being split or ripped; and that the plaintiff has nowhere in his specification noticed this necessity. Very great stress is laid- upon this objection. It is beyond controversy that the plaintiff's machine will operate usefully without such strap or check at the top, and, indeed, that there is no occasion for it when the boots to. be treed are all of a certain size. Now, if a new machine is invented by which one class of boots is usefully treed, why is not such invention patentable? It may be true that the plaintiff’s invention is rendered more useful by the use •of a strap. But how frequent it is that the practical utility of a new invention is increased by new improvements, or by the use of old instrumentalities or appliances which the inventor has not mentioned either because it did not occur to him, or because he deemed it wholly unnecessary to point out what must be plain to every operator.
